Meet the demands of specialized applications with our Metric Viton O-Rings. Engineered from high-grade Viton material, these O-Rings feature exceptional mechanical properties, compression set resistance, and a Shore A hardness of 75. Rapid deformation recovery and excellent memory ensure reliable sealing performance. With an inside diameter of 300.00 mm and a cross-section width of 6.00 mm, these Metric O-Rings are designed for a suggested operating temperature range of -10°F to +300°F. Trusted for their quality and durability, these O-Rings are ideal for encapsulated applications in various industries.
